The '''shielded dead Elite''' [[glitches|glitch]] is a phenomenon that occurs in ''[[Halo: Combat Evolved]]'' and, when [[lag]] is involved, in ''[[Halo 3]]''<nowiki>'</nowiki>s [[multiplayer]]. It can cause the corpse of an [[Sangheili|Elite]] to still have an active [[Sangheili personal energy shield|personal energy shield]] despite the shield's deactivation typically being a prerequisite to them dying at all. | |||
==Walkthrough== | |||
===''Halo: Combat Evolved''=== | |||
To perform this, find any Elite, in any level, on any difficulty. Without inflicting any damage on the Elite, [[assassin Medal|assassinate]] it. Then, shoot his corpse. It should flicker, as though the Elite's shield were still functioning. This works with all types of Elites, and even [[Sangheili Zealot|Zealots]]. | |||
The easiest way to see this glitch is to start [[Assault on the Control Room]], and play until you get to the bridge. There is an Elite on the lower level (usually a [[Sangheili Major|Major]]). Simply catch him off guard, assassinate him, and shoot his corpse to see the glitch. | |||
